A Brief History: From Locker Room to Runway
The story of the Adidas Adilette begins in the post-war era, a time when practicality and functionality were paramount. Born from a need for simple, hygienic footwear for athletes, the Adilette's simple, slip-on design quickly gained traction in changing rooms and pools. Its minimalist aesthetic, characterized by its three iconic stripes and comfortable footbed, resonated with athletes and non-athletes alike. What started as a purely functional piece of sportswear evolved over the decades, subtly adapting to changing fashion trends while maintaining its core design principles.
The Adilette's transformation from a utilitarian item to a fashion staple is a testament to its timeless design. Its effortless coolness has made it a favorite among designers, celebrities, and everyday consumers. Its presence on runways and in street style photography solidified its position as a versatile accessory, proving that comfort and style can coexist harmoniously. This evolution is evident in the diverse range of colors, materials, and collaborations that Adidas has introduced over the years, showcasing the enduring appeal of this seemingly simple slide.
